CodingSeb.ExpressionEvaluator 1.4.0

A Simple Math and Pseudo C# Expression Evaluator in One C# File. Can also execute small C# like scripts

Install-Package CodingSeb.ExpressionEvaluator -Version 1.4.0
dotnet add package CodingSeb.ExpressionEvaluator --version 1.4.0
<PackageReference Include="CodingSeb.ExpressionEvaluator" Version="1.4.0" />
For projects that support PackageReference, copy this XML node into the project file to reference the package.
paket add CodingSeb.ExpressionEvaluator --version 1.4.0
The NuGet Team does not provide support for this client. Please contact its maintainers for support.

Release Notes

Warning some breaking changes in the on the fly variables and function evaluations.
Deep changes to allow more customization

* Custom operators or custom expression parsing with inheritance
* Manage <> in on the fly evaluations to evaluate generic types
* 2 additional on the fly evaluation (Preevaluation)
* optionally use var before variable assignation (For better copy paste with C# code)
* option to globally cache namespaces and types resolution (to speed up multiple evaluation)
* Correction of Array/collection indexing when using OptionForceIntegernumbersEvaluationsAsDoubleDyDefault=true
* Some other corrections and refactorings

This package is not used by any popular GitHub repositories.

Version History

Version Downloads Last updated
1.4.0 401 5/28/2019
1.3.7 224 4/10/2019
1.3.6 132 4/2/2019
1.3.5 116 3/28/2019
1.3.4 161 3/14/2019
1.3.3 124 2/15/2019
1.3.2 210 1/19/2019
1.3.1 172 1/10/2019
1.3.0 858 12/6/2018
1.2.2 213 10/31/2018
1.2.1 301 8/2/2018
1.2.0 225 7/31/2018
1.0.2 263 5/16/2018
1.0.1 277 5/7/2018
1.0.0 244 5/7/2018